.basic13__sharing{list-style:none;margin:0;padding:0}.basic13{background:#fff;display:inline-block;height:3rem;overflow:hidden;position:relative;transition:width .75s ease,background-color .5s ease;width:3rem;z-index:9}@media screen and (min-width:47.5em){.basic13:hover{background-color:#ebeff1;width:15rem}}@media screen and (min-width:47.5em) and (min-width:47.5em){.basic13:hover{width:12rem}}@media screen and (max-width:47.4375em){.basic13--open{background-color:#ebeff1;width:15rem}}@media screen and (max-width:47.4375em) and (min-width:47.5em){.basic13--open{width:12rem}}.basic13__trigger{background:url(../../../img/layout/basic/ico-sharing.svg) -12rem top no-repeat #fff;cursor:pointer;height:0;overflow:hidden;padding-top:3rem;position:absolute;right:0;top:0;transition:background-color .2s ease;width:3rem;z-index:2}@media screen and (max-width:47.4375em){.basic13--open .basic13__trigger{background-color:#ebeff1;background-position:-15rem top}.basic13--open .basic13__trigger:hover{background-color:#006ed1;background-position:-15rem -3rem}}@media screen and (min-width:47.5em){.basic13:hover .basic13__trigger{background-color:#ebeff1}}.basic13__sharing{display:flex;left:0;position:absolute;top:0;width:15rem;z-index:1}@media screen and (min-width:47.5em){.basic13__sharing{width:12rem}}.basic13__sharing-link{background:url(../../../img/layout/basic/ico-sharing.svg) 0 0 no-repeat;display:block;height:0;overflow:hidden;padding-top:3rem;width:3rem}.basic13__sharing-link:hover{background-color:rgba(0,127,255,.08)}.basic13__sharing-link:active{background-color:rgba(24,64,132,.16)}.basic13__sharing-link--fb{background-position:-9rem top}.basic13__sharing-link--fb:hover{background-position:-9rem -3rem}.basic13__sharing-link--fb:active{background-position:-9rem -6rem}.basic13__sharing-link--tw{background-position:-6rem top}.basic13__sharing-link--tw:hover{background-position:-6rem -3rem}.basic13__sharing-link--tw:active{background-position:-6rem -6rem}.basic13__sharing-link--in{background-position:-3rem top}.basic13__sharing-link--in:hover{background-position:-3rem -3rem}.basic13__sharing-link--in:active{background-position:-3rem -6rem}.basic13__sharing-link--wa{background-position:0 top}@media screen and (min-width:47.5em){.basic13__sharing-link--wa{display:none}}.basic13__sharing-link--wa:hover{background-position:0 -3rem}.basic13__sharing-link--wa:active{background-position:0 -6rem}.page--doc .basic13{display:block;margin-left:auto}